Ayurveda Cooking Class

Our Ayurveda Cooking classes are a great introduction to Ayurvedic cooking. You’ll learn about the healing properties of spices, the different types of foods (Sattvic, Tamasic and Rajasic) and how to adapt your diet to suit your constitution (dosha). Our half day Ayurvedic cooking class is hands on experience where you’ll learn the basics of Ayurvedic cooking and get to prepare, cook and sample a variety of delicious foods and flavours.

What is Ayurveda

Holistic Healing

Ayurveda is a traditional Indian healing system that dates back over 5000 years. It is widely used across India, where it sits alongside mainstream Western Medicine. Ayurveda is a holistic practice that looks at the mind, body and spirit and creates a tailored program based on your unique constitutional make-up (dosha) to promote health, wellbeing and balance in your life.

Balanced Lifestyle

Ayurveda philosophy believes that people, their health, and the universe are all related. It is believed that health problems can result when these relationships are out of balance. The Ayurvedic lifestyle seeks to cleanse, restore and revitalise the body, mind and spirit through a range of therapies. Therapies include massage, cleansing and detoxification, acupressure points (marma) and herbal remedies, along with diet, yoga, meditation and breathwork.
